|
Other payables and accrued liabilities (Details) - USD ($)
|
Sep. 30, 2025
|
Jun. 30, 2025
|DisclosureLineElements [Line Items]
|Other accrued liabilities and payables
|$ 1,176,041
|$ 1,893,921
|Accrued Payables For Inventory In Transit [Member]
|DisclosureLineElements [Line Items]
|Other accrued liabilities and payables
|0
|262,570
|Credit Cards Payable [Member]
|DisclosureLineElements [Line Items]
|Other accrued liabilities and payables
|364,117
|149,276
|Customer Deposit [Member]
|DisclosureLineElements [Line Items]
|Other accrued liabilities and payables
|197,511
|291,995
|Accrued Amazon Fees [Member]
|DisclosureLineElements [Line Items]
|Other accrued liabilities and payables
|77,191
|76,534
|Sales Taxes Payable [Member]
|DisclosureLineElements [Line Items]
|Other accrued liabilities and payables
|436,683
|552,346
|Payroll Liabilities [Member]
|DisclosureLineElements [Line Items]
|Other accrued liabilities and payables
|100,398
|560,387
|Other Accrued Liabilities And Payables [Member]
|DisclosureLineElements [Line Items]
|Other accrued liabilities and payables
|$ 141
|$ 813
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Amount of liabilities incurred and payable to vendors for goods and services received classified as other, and expenses incurred but not yet paid, payable within one year or the operating cycle, if longer.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details